ECM Program Manager
Pacific Health Group | Transforming Care Through Connection
At Pacific Health Group, we’re more than just a healthcare organization—we’re driving real change. As an ECM Program Manager, you’ll lead our Enhanced Care Management program, making sure vulnerable populations get the care, support, and advocacy they need to live healthier, more stable lives. You’ll guide regional teams to deliver compassionate, person-centered care that improves outcomes and supports our mission to close health equity gaps across California.
Role OverviewThis position is all about leadership, program oversight, and innovation. You’ll supervise Lead Care Managers, across the hiring county, ensuring the team has the support and resources needed to succeed. You’ll oversee program quality, member services, cross-functional partnerships, budgeting, and program growth initiatives. Your work will directly impact the lives of high-need populations while strengthening Pacific Health Group’s reputation for excellence in care.
Key ResponsibilitiesTeam Leadership & Supervision
- Mentor and guide Lead Care Managers across multiple counties.
- Conduct weekly one-on-ones to address challenges, review caseloads, and provide coaching.
- Lead weekly team meetings to share updates, review cases, and encourage collaboration.
- Meet in-person with staff regularly to maintain strong leadership presence.
Program Development & Quality Assurance
- Establish benchmarks and metrics to track program performance.
- Implement quality assurance protocols and standardized workflows.
- Monitor staff performance and use data to identify trends and improvement opportunities.
Member Services Oversight
- Ensure members are receiving in-person visits and high-quality care.
- Monitor documentation and provide support for challenging cases.
- Implement strategies to improve member engagement and satisfaction.
Cross-Functional Collaboration
- Serve as liaison between ECM program and hospitals, providers, and community organizations.
- Collaborate with data and compliance teams to track outcomes and maintain regulatory standards.
- Strengthen partnerships to improve care transitions and reduce hospital readmissions.
Budget & Resource Management
- Develop and manage program budgets, allocate resources efficiently, and track expenditures.
- Adjust staffing and resources based on member needs and program priorities.
Program Innovation & Growth
- Identify opportunities to enhance program effectiveness.
- Pilot new initiatives such as telehealth to expand access to care.
- Stay current on best practices and integrate improvements.
Additional Examples
- Lead operational huddles and bi-weekly case conferences.
- Develop mentorship programs and regional trainings for staff.
- Prepare quarterly performance reports and maintain stakeholder relationships.
Education & Experience
- Bachelor’s or Master’s in Healthcare Administration, Public Health, Nursing, or related field.
- 5+ years in healthcare management, including 3+ years in care/case management.
- 2+ years managing Enhanced Care Management or intensive care management programs.
Knowledge & Skills
- Understanding of care management principles and healthcare delivery systems.
- Experience with Medicaid/Medicare programs and ECM program requirements.
- Strong analytical skills and experience in data-driven program evaluation.
Personal Attributes
- Strong leadership and communication skills.
-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
- Commitment to person-centered care and health equity.
Working Conditions
- Regular travel (65%) to county sites in California.
- Occasional evening or weekend availability for program initiatives.
Compensation
- Pay : $80,000 - $90,000 annual salary
Requirements
- Must reside within hiring county
- Valid California Driver's License and active auto insurance meeting CA requirements
- Reliable personal vehicle for daily work use
- Successful completion of background check (including MVR)
- Must be able to travel up to 60-70% within the county to conduct in person visits
- Must successfully complete a Testlify skills assessment
- Must have a reliable working laptop for the first 21 days of employment (personal equipment stipend) until company issued laptop is received
- Must have effective Time Management skills
- Must have internet speed of - 300+ mbps download and 25+mbps upload
- Must be proficient in technology, including documentation systems, case management platforms, and communication tools
- Must be willing to work occasional evenings and weekends as needed.
